
Fuzzy's Great Escape (Class Pets #1) by Bruce Hale
What do class pets get up to when students aren't around? Adventure -- and lots of trouble!Fuzzy is the ambitious and unfortunately named guinea pig of class 5B. He has big plans for this year -- namely, to be president of the Class Pets Club. Then the cutest, most charming new bunny shows up and spins Fuzzy's plan like a hamster wheel. There's only one way to topple the adorable new club president: Fuzzy is taking the pets on a field trip!Bruce Hale (www.brucehale.com), an Edgar Award nominee, is passionate about encouraging reluctant readers to read. He's written or illustrated over 30 children's books, including The Curse of the Were-Hyena, the first in the Monstertown Mysteries series, the famous Chet Gecko Mysteries series, and the Clark the Shark picture book series. Bruce is in high demand as a speaker, having spoken at conferences, universities, and schools across North America. He is also a Fulbright Scholar in Storytelling. Regional advertising, theater, and an independent film, The Ride, are among his acting credits. The Malted Falcon, Bruce's novel, was a finalist for the Edgar Award.
The Little D Award for Comedy Writing went to Murder, My Tweet. He resides in the city of Santa Barbara, California.
